Ruby (Thorrington)
Dessert · Apple · Malus domestica Borkh. · 1 accession
Raised by F.W. Thorrington, a retired London Customs Officer, Hornchurch, Essex. Received by the National Fruit Trials in 1925. Fruits have firm, sweet flesh with little flavour.
